Then on bake day, take the tart shells from the freezer, prebake as directed in the recipe, fill with the prepared filling, and bake.</description> <content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Rachael, most likely yes, but some quality will be lost. Try freezing them after baking and see what result you get. On the other hand, why not make and freeze the unbaked tart shells (which, if well wrapped, will keep for months in the freezer), and then make the filling and store in the frig until needed (will keep  for several days)?
